Living in Fairmount, Philadelphia: Culture, Charm, and Community
Known as Philadelphia’s “Art Museum Area,” Fairmount is a lively and picturesque neighborhood that offers residents the perfect balance of culture, convenience, and community. With its grand parkways, historic architecture, and proximity to the city’s most famous cultural institutions, Fairmount delivers a unique lifestyle that appeals to both long-time Philadelphians and newcomers alike.
Fairmount is home to the Philadelphia Museum of Art, famous for its iconic “Rocky Steps” as well as the Rodin Museum, the Barnes Foundation, and the Franklin Institute just a short stroll away. Residents enjoy unparalleled access to art exhibitions, performances, and cultural events throughout the year.
Just beyond the neighborhood’s edge lies the Schuylkill River Trail, offering miles of scenic paths for walking, running, and cycling. Fairmount also borders Fairmount Park, one of the largest urban park systems in the country, where residents can enjoy picnics, festivals, and outdoor recreation in every season.
Fairmount’s dining scene is as eclectic as its residents. From cozy cafés and gastropubs to fine dining establishments, there’s something for every palate. Popular spots include bistros serving modern American fare, family-run Italian restaurants, and lively brunch destinations that draw food lovers from across the city.
The neighborhood’s streets are lined with historic rowhomes, brownstones, and modern condominiums. Many properties feature original architectural details alongside updated interiors, offering the perfect mix of character and comfort.
Fairmount maintains a friendly, neighborhood feel despite its proximity to Center City. Local events like block parties, farmers markets, and seasonal festivals keep the community connected and vibrant. Residents take pride in their neighborhood, fostering a welcoming environment for newcomers.
With Center City just minutes away, Fairmount offers easy access to Philadelphia’s business, dining, and entertainment districts. Whether commuting for work or exploring the city, residents enjoy the convenience of being close to major highways, public transportation, and bike-friendly routes.
